Lokal
German
Etymology
Borrowed from French local, from Latin localis.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/loˈkaːl/
Audio: (file) - Rhymes: -aːl
Noun
Lokal n (strong, genitive Lokales or Lokals, plural Lokale)
- A restaurant, especially when small and/or traditional; a pub that serves hot food; an inn.
- (in certain compounds) A room or facility used for public services.
- Wahllokal ― polling station
- Wartelokal ― waiting room
Usage notes
- Note that Lokal is a false friend and does not mean "local". The general word to refer to a "local" is Einheimischer/Einheimische if you are referring to a person who was born somewhere and has always lived there.
- To refer to the same meaning the same as the English locale, on the other hand, there are Ort m and Örtlichkeit f.

Synonyms
- (pub serving food): Gaststätte; Gastwirtschaft; Wirtschaft; Restaurant
